Getting the Canon PIXMA MG3660 Driver Running on Your System
Installing the Canon PIXMA MG3660 Driver on your computer is straightforward. Follow these carefully outlined steps to ensure a successful setup on your specific operating system. Be sure to have the installer file ready on your computer before you start.
Installing the Canon PIXMA MG3660 Driver on Windows
- Locate the downloaded installer file in your Downloads folder or the designated location where your files are saved.
- Run the installer executable by double-clicking on the file. This action will initiate the installation process.
- Accept any User Account Control (UAC) prompts that may appear to allow the setup to proceed with the required permissions.
- Follow the on-screen prompts to accept the license agreement and select installation preferences tailored to your needs.
- Complete the installation by clicking on the “Finish” button once prompted. Windows may suggest a restart to finalize the installation.
- Connect the printer through the “Device Manager” if it doesn’t automatically detect the new hardware. Adjust printer ports if necessary.
- Verify printer connectivity by printing a test page from the printer settings in the Control Panel.
Installing the Canon PIXMA MG3660 Driver on macOS
- Open the downloaded file from your Downloads folder, which will likely be in a .dmg or .pkg format.
- Run the installer by double-clicking the package, which opens the installation wizard for configuration.
- Follow on-screen instructions to complete necessary permissions and accept the software license agreement.
- Navigate to System Preferences, then go to “Printers & Scanners” to add the Canon PIXMA MG3660 printer.
- Ensure any required System Extensions are enabled as prompted during installation for full functionality.
- Final check: Confirm that your printer appears in the Printers & Scanners list before printing a test page.
- Restart your Mac if prompted, to apply all changes and enable full driver functionality.

Troubleshooting the Canon PIXMA MG3660 Driver
Challenges may arise during interaction with the Canon PIXMA MG3660 Driver, such as connectivity or printing errors. Here are some helpful solutions to consider:
- Connection Issues: Ensure that the printer is properly connected to the Wi-Fi network and that the correct drivers are installed.
- Error Messages: Refer to the user manual for specific error codes; these often contain troubleshooting steps specific to the issue.
- Slow Printing: Check for print queue clutter or restart your device to clear potential software glitches.
- Compatibility Warnings: Verify that the installed version of the driver matches your current operating system requirements.
